`
Ryee
  • 浏览: 283527 次
  • 性别: Icon_minigender_1
  • 来自: 上海
社区版块
存档分类
最新评论

数据采集中常用的SQL语句

sql 
阅读更多

数据采集中常用的SQL语句

   相同的SQL语句运用到不同数据库中会有略微的差别,对字符变量的要求,相关函数的变化,以及语法规则的不同等等,例如:oracle数据库中对字段命名 别名时不需要as 字符,没有month(),year()等时间函数等等,access数据库中在使用inner join执行内部联合时条件需用(),当然还有很多的细微差别,大家可以自己去寻找总结。下面的示例以SQL SERVER为基础编写。

1. 抽取非重复数据

select distinct var1 from tableName;

2. 抽取某个时间段间的数据

select var1,var2 from 数据表 where 字段名 between 时间1 and 时间2;
3. 连接多个变量

select '123'+cast(456 as varchar);

select '123'+cast(456 as varchar)+'789';

4. 用SQL语句找出表名为Table1中的处在ID字段中1-200条记录中Name字段包含w的所有记录

select * from Table1 where id between 1 and 200 and Name like '%w%';

5. 找出拥有超过10名客户的地区的列表

select country from test group by country having count(customerId)>10;
6. 关于取出每个部门工资最高的前三人

select * from table t where 工资 in (select top 3 工资 from table where 部门 = t.部门 order by 工资 desc);  
7. 两个结构完全相同的表a和b,主键为index,使用SQL语句,把a表中存在但在b表中不存在的数据插入的b表中

insert into b select * from a where not exists(select * from b where "index"=a."index");  
8.从一个数据库中的多个数据表提取相关变量

Select table1.var1,table2.var2,table2.var3,

From table1 inner join table2

On tabel1.var1=table2.var1

Inner join table3

On tabel1.var2=table3.var2

(order by ……)

分享到:
评论

相关推荐

    数据采集器读写_sqlserver_sql_读写sql_采集器_

    在数据采集过程中,"读写SQL"是指通过执行SQL语句从数据库中获取数据(读取)以及向数据库中插入、更新或删除数据(写入)。以下是一些关键的SQL操作: 1. **SELECT语句**:这是最基本的读取数据的方法,用于从一个...

    SQL.zip_LABVIEW SQL语句_LabVIEW SQL

    学习这部分知识,你将能够有效地在LabVIEW环境中进行数据库操作,这对于进行实时数据采集、数据分析或者控制系统等项目来说是极其重要的。记得在实际操作中,一定要注意SQL注入安全问题,避免不安全的SQL构造,以...

    Top-SQL Tuning SQL语句调整

    标题与描述中的“Top-SQL Tuning SQL语句调整”主要聚焦于提升SQL查询的效率与性能,这是数据库管理与优化的重要组成部分。SQL语句的性能直接影响到应用程序的响应时间和系统的整体性能,因此,掌握有效的SQL调优...

    c#上位机数据采集源代码

    文件存储时需要考虑并发写入的同步问题,而数据库存储则涉及数据结构设计和SQL语句编写。 5. **实时图表显示**:为了直观地反映数据变化,系统还提供了实时图表功能。这可能利用了第三方库如ZedGraph、LiveCharts或...

    一种高效的SQL语句执行线程.pdf

    在软件平台的采集、处理、解释一体化过程中,不可避免地会大量执行SQL语句。特别是在处理大量数据,如在插入(INSERT)、更新(UPDATE)、删除(DELETE)等操作时,这些不需要返回数据的SQL语句会占据主要比例。 为...

    凡客诚品数据采集器(省市区)

    在具体应用上,这款数据采集器提供了SQL语句支持,这意味着它可以方便地与数据库系统对接。默认支持SQL Server,用户可以根据自己的需求,将采集到的省市区信息存储到SQL Server数据库中,便于后续的数据处理和分析...

    如何利用VF程序来提取SQL语句中的结构信息.pdf

    总结而言,本文所述的VF程序能够有效地从SQL语句中提取结构信息,并将其以文本文件的形式保存,从而大大简化了金融审计中数据采集和转换的工作量。该程序的通用性和自动化特点,使其在处理大量数据结构信息时显得尤...

    SQL语句_Scarlett

    1. **选择(SELECT)**:这是最常用的SQL语句,用于从表中选取数据。例如,`SELECT * FROM Customers`会选取Customers表中的所有记录。 2. **投影( Projection)**:通过指定列名,我们可以选择特定的列。例如,`...

    ifeng多线程新闻采集器,支持SQL语句

    工具必须依赖Microsoft .NET ...软件支持SQL语句设置,只要写好SQL语句就可以将采集回来的新闻插入到数据库,目前仅支持SQL Server。 不懂的用的小白不要乱评论,这款工具适合有一定SQL Server基础的朋友使用。

    &精妙SQL语句

    【描述】:“&精妙SQL语句.chm和文档”表明这个压缩包中包含了一个CHM格式的手册和一些文档,这些都是学习SQL技巧的重要资源。CHM是Microsoft编写的帮助文件格式,通常包含丰富的技术文档和教程。文档可能是PDF或者...

    力控5.0SQL语句使用样例

    4. 工程实践:通过SQL_TEST.PCK学习实际项目中的SQL应用,如数据采集、报警处理和报告生成。 5. 设备通信:理解和应用"快速接线模块.pdf"中的内容,学习如何使用SQL语句实现与现场设备的高效数据交换。 6. 文件...

    Labview压力位移数据采集

    通过编写SQL语句,我们可以将数据插入到预定义的表中,或者从表中检索特定的数据段。 在“Pressure assembly monitoring system”中,数据显示和判断功能是必不可少的。LabVIEW的图表和指示器控件可以实时展示压力...

    串口数据采集入MySQL数据库V2.0

    4. **数据入库**:经过解析和验证的数据会被格式化成SQL语句,然后通过MySQL API执行插入操作,将数据保存到预设的数据库表中。通常,每个设备或传感器对应一个或多个特定的数据库表。 5. **错误处理**:系统应具备...

    SQL性能采集工具

    SQL性能采集工具主要关注的是SQL语句的执行效率,通过监控和收集SQL语句的运行数据,来找出可能成为系统瓶颈的SQL操作,进而进行优化。 该工具的核心功能包括: 1. **CPU占用监控**:它能够实时监测哪些SQL语句在...

    网站数据采集分析

    网站数据采集分析是一种重要的数据处理技术,用于从各种网页中获取有用信息并进行深度分析,以便于业务决策、市场研究和用户行为理解。在给定的描述中,我们可以看到一个基于Struts2和JDBC实现的数据采集分析系统,...

    sql server2008性能参数获取语句

    为了查询SQL Server 2008服务内存的具体使用情况,可以使用以下T-SQL语句: ```sql SELECT SUM(single_pages_kb) + SUM(multi_pages_kb) FROM ( SELECT SUM(single_pages_kb) AS single_pages_kb, SUM(multi_pages...

    《数据采集》实践报告模板.doc

    - **功能二:存入数据库的每个数据表中** 设计数据库模型,建立与Python的连接,使用SQL语句将数据插入到对应的表中。 - **功能三:数据加工** 对主演信息进行处理,可能涉及字符串分割、去重等操作,为后续的数据...

    Oracle数据库系统数据采集讲座

    Oracle数据库系统数据采集是审计工作中的重要环节,它涉及到数据的获取、恢复、转换和分析。在审计过程中,数据采集的目的是将审计需求转化为可复用的分析模板,并理解数据结构以便于审计。 1. 审计数据一般运动...

    C#数据采集例子

    在IT行业中,数据采集是一项重要的任务,特别是在大数据分析、网站监控和信息挖掘等领域。C#是一种广泛用于开发桌面应用、Web应用以及服务器端程序的强大编程语言,它也提供了丰富的库和工具来支持数据采集工作。在...

Global site tag (gtag.js) - Google Analytics